How can I connect an IKEA Matter smart product to the DIRIGERA app?

If you've just bought an IKEA Matter-compatible product, this guide will help you how to make the first connection.

Before you start
  • Make sure your IKEA Home smart app and DIRIGERA hub are updated to the latest version.
  • Power the product By installing the power cable, installing the bulb, or inserting batteries.
  • Smart products from IKEA are ready to plug in for 15 minutes as soon as they are turned on.
 

The app will let you know when you're ready to connect

When the IKEA Home smart app finds a product, you will get a message that asks if you want to add the product to your home.
This means that the product is ready to connect.
After 15 minutes, the pairing window will close and you will need to start over:
Press the system button once To start a new 15-minute pairing window. For smart lights, turn the light on and off again.

Stay close while connecting

  • Smart products are connected using Bluetooth (BLE). Make sure you keep your phone close to the hub and the product while they connect.
  • Matter products use a different network than the older IKEA smart products, like TRÅDFRI. It is important to Stay close to the hub To establish a strong connection, especially when connecting your first product.

If nothing happens

  • Sometimes a product stops being visible to your phone. This can happen if the connection has tried and failed multiple times.
  • Try one Factory Reset to clean up old connections and start over. Factory reset by holding the system button for a long time for 10 seconds. For smart lights, follow the instructions in the IKEA Home smart app to turn the light on and off 6 times at a specific rhythm.
    A factory reset will erase old data or previous connections, so The product can reconnect like new.
    A 15 minute pairing window will automatically open when the factory reset is complete.
  • Reset the Thread network - Sometimes the Thread network can get mismatched if a product tries and fails to connect multiple times. In this case, we recommend resetting the Thread network:
    Go to hub settings in the IKEA Home smart app to reset the Thread network
    The app will help you reset so the network can build a stable base
    Matter products connected to your Thread network will need to reset once the network is ready.
